You def want flames of the blood hand over browbeat or shard volley over browbeat. You never want to run brow. its a trap. Its discussed in this thread and in legacy burn thread how its a trick. And with your split of flamebreak and anger of the gods , most will say that you should run volcanic fallout over both because it can't be countered, but its kinda a meta choice. since they sound like they worked well, id say your good, but if you wanna be safe against counters, switch 'em. Jet doesnt work for me but you are running 20 mountains, so id say keep it. Searing Blaze has never failed me but there are spells you can replace it with if need be. I still say our go to 2 for 3 damage spell is Incinerate . Otherwise, welcome back and looking forward to more info/results.
